Marc Camille Chaimowicz's Biography

Marc Camille Chaimowicz is a French contemporary artist and designer, born in 1947. He is known for his multimedia installations and furniture designs, which combine modernist minimalism with poetic and humorous elements. Chaimowicz's installations often involve everyday objects, such as chairs or lamps, that have been arranged in unexpected ways. He has exhibited extensively throughout Europe, including at the Centre Pompidou in Paris, the Tate Modern in London, and the Museum of Modern Art in New York. He has also collaborated with fashion brands such as Comme des Garçons and Hermès. Chaimowicz is influenced by a wide range of artistic movements, including surrealism, postmodernism and dadaism.
